Lek Kee Authentic Teochew Braised Duck (陸記正宗潮洲鹵鸭), People's Park Food Centre

Have noticed the queue in front of this stall (#01-1104 People’s Park Food Centre, 32 New Market Road) every time I've been to People's Park Food Centre. Curiosity finally prevailed. I was told that I might have eaten from them many years ago but I don't remember. Since I don't remember, today was a fresh take on their Teochew styled braises.

Lek Kee Authentic Teochew Braised Duck (陸記正宗潮洲鹵鸭), braised duck and parts

This was a portion of mixed braises which included the bottom quarter of braised duck, pig's skin, pig's tongue, a stewed egg and some livers. Duck meat was moist and had a good bite to the texture. Tongue was less tender but had a flavour from the stewing sauce thoroughly infused into them. Pig's skin was tender and chewy. I like the sweet/savoury braising sauce which was in my opinion, all that was needed for the platter.

Lek Kee Authentic Teochew Braised Duck (陸記正宗潮洲鹵鸭), chilli

Not that the chilli wasn't nice. These had a tanginess from lime and a savoury bit of heat from the darker chilli paste. But I found myself getting by without much of them

Lek Kee Authentic Teochew Braised Duck (陸記正宗潮洲鹵鸭), rice

The extra braising sauce from the platter can be generously drizzled onto their rice for more deliciousness.
